Transaction 15037c44a1d96b04a1d058e91a79fccf4cde9f154436cb52472c3f9929c3b930
1 Input
1 Output
-
15037c44a1d96b04a1d058e91a79fccf4cde9f154436cb52472c3f9929c3b930:0
- value
- 12696992
- script pubkey
- OP_0 OP_PUSHBYTES_20 5309cff00593432fcd617e0e5d918918a6d46bad
- address
- ltc1q2vyuluq9jdpjlntp0c89myvfrzndg6adw3csal